| Minimum PC Requirements | |
|
Windows System Version: Windows 10/11 (64-bit) RAM: ≥ 32 GB CPU: Intel i7 13th Gen or AMD Ryzen 7 5800 GPU: N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3060 (8 GB) |
macOS System Version: macOS 11.0 or better RAM(MetroX): ≥ 16 GB RAM(MetroX Pro): ≥ 18 GB CPU (MetroX): M1 Pro/Max/Ultra CPU(MetroX Pro): M3 Pro/M4 |
| Revo Measure V1.1.0 Updates: | |
|
1. Adds template measurement for batch measuring a single model, allowing users to create custom templates. 2. Adds cone feature support. 3. Adds batch feature creation from CAD models. 4. Adds distance measurement along the X, Y, and Z axes. 5. Adds point deviation measurement at specified locations. 6. Adds feature creation from a reference mesh model. 7. Adds model unit settings, supporting millimeters, centimeters, meters, inches, and feet. 8. Adds decimal precision settings for model data. 9. Adds a lasso selector. 10. Fixes some bugs. 11. Optimizes user experience for certain features. |
